-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E----- Hash: SHA256 Hello there, I've been trying to run some recent SLURM versiones (14.03.11 and 15.08.0-0pre3) in simulation node and things get stuck during node registration stage.
When I run slurmd it can't connect to the controller daemon and these messages appear on screen: slurmd: debug2: _slurm_connect failed: Connection refused slurmd: debug2: Error connecting slurm stream socket at 127.0.0.1:6817: Connection refused slurmd: debug: Failed to contact primary controller: Connection refused Everything is running in a single VM (Ubuntu Server 14.04 LTS) and there's no firewall up (no iptables rules or anything like that). I made different configuration in slurm.conf regarding hostnames and had no luck. I double checked connectivity using tcpdump, telnet and nc, and in all situations it was possible to connect to the 3 ports used (6817, 6818 and 6819). The same message appear no matter what SLURM version I'm using (I have to note that there's no mix regarding versions, I mean, when using 14.03.11 all the daemons involved belong to this version, the same goes to 15.08.0). The sequence for starting daemons are: 1) sim_mgr 2) slurmctld 3) slurmd The compilation options used were --enable-simulator and - --enable-frontend. �Any suggestion?
